The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in the South East requiring CAD sk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 1 January 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
1 Jan 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 219 210 187
Rank change year-on-year -9 -23 +120
Permanent jobs citing CAD 56 92 83
As % of all permanent jobs in the South East 0.54% 1.00% 1.07%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 0.67% 1.13% 1.19%
Number of salaries quoted 44 16 25
10th Percentile £30,500 - £30,750
25th Percentile £35,000 £43,750 £47,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£40,000 £52,073 £55,050
Median % change year-on-year -23.18% -5.41% +46.77%
75th Percentile £44,202 £67,813 £67,500
90th Percentile £50,850 £90,000 £84,750
England median annual salary £40,000 £50,000 £52,350
% change year-on-year -20.00% -4.49% +39.60%

CAD falls under the Processes and Methodologies category. For comparison with the information above, the following table provides summary statistics for all permanent job vacancies requiring process or methodology skills in the South East.

Permanent vacancies with a requirement for process or methodology skills 8,378 8,110 6,969
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the South East 80.85% 87.72% 89.80%
Number of salaries quoted 4,956 3,982 4,915
10th Percentile £27,750 £32,750 £30,000
25th Percentile £34,000 £44,253 £39,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£50,000 £57,500 £53,500
Median % change year-on-year -13.04% +7.48% -2.73%
75th Percentile £65,000 £75,000 £67,500
90th Percentile £80,000 £85,000 £82,000
England median annual salary £55,000 £60,000 £60,000
% change year-on-year -8.33% - -4.00%
